| what your body needs to survive | oxygen and nutrients and a means of removing waste products from the cells |
| circulatory system | provides the means of delivering oxygen and nutrient rich blood to each cell & transporting waste products to be removed from the body |
| the heart | the main pump of the circulatory system |
| the heart is one of these | a muscle that pumps blood to all parts of your body |
| how to keep your heart healthy | understand how it works and take care of it |
| the shape of the heart | a pear |
| where the heart is located | in the center of the chest behind the sternum |
| size of the average heart | about the size of a clenched fist |
| how many times your heart beats in a minute | 60-100 times |
| average number of times your heart beats in a day | 100,000 times |
| American Heart Association (AHA) | educates people about healthy things to do for their heart; they have a list of recommendations for healthier eating |
| 4 parts of your blood | red blood cells, white blood cells, platelets, plasma |
